Volcanic Streams
Lava flows are extensive sheets of rock formed when highly fluid molten rock erupts from a volcanic vent and spreads over a wide area. These events often occur in shield volcanoes or flood basalt provinces, where the thickness of the molten rock is low enough to allow it to travel considerable distances. In contrast to explosive eruptions that build get more info steep cones, basalt streams tend to create broad, gently sloping landscapes. The resulting terrain can be remarkably flat, exhibiting columnar jointing as the lava cools and contracts, a striking visual characteristic revealing the magma's journey. They represent some of the most voluminous forms of volcanism on our planet.

Tectonic Strikes
Sudden shifts along fault lines—often linked to the relentless dance of earth’s crust—manifest as what we commonly call seismic activity. These powerful events release tremendous energy, generating shock waves that propagate through the earth. The magnitude of an seismic event – and subsequently its intensity – is influenced by factors such as the depth of the fault and the amount of movement that occurs.
